目的:探討母親對兒童體重知覺的準確度及其影響知覺準確度的因子為何,並分析知覺準確度和兒童健康行為、日常行為間的關聯性。
方法:本研究擬以2005年臺灣地區「國民健康訪問暨藥物濫用調查」資料進行分析,以3-11歲兒童及其母親為研究對象。研究變項包括基本資料、每月家戶收入、兒童的健康行為、母親對兒童體重知覺等。統計方式以Pearson’s Chi-square tests考驗不同背景變項與知覺準確度間的關係、知覺準確度與兒童健康行為、與日常生活行為間的關係。統計水準設定為α=.05。
結果:3-11歲兒童近45%兒童的體重狀態為異常,其中體重過重及肥胖者為24.4%,而母親對於兒童體重的知覺方面,有35%的母親是知覺錯誤的。兒童年齡、母親年齡、母親籍貫與每月家戶收入都與母親的知覺準確度有關,在羅吉斯迴歸分析方面也發現,兒童年齡較低者、母親年齡低者、原住民籍貫者及每月家戶收入少於3萬元者有較高的風險對兒童的體重狀態知覺錯誤。母親對兒童體重知覺的準確性與體重異常兒童是否採取正確的體重控制有關,此外,母親知覺正確組的兒童在看電視與玩電動的時間也比較少,並且在蔬菜水果的食物攝取上也會有比較高的頻率。
結論:母親對兒童體重狀態的知覺準確性明顯與兒童是否能正確的控制體重、兒童花費在靜態休閒活動時間的多寡以及日常生活的飲食型態有關,而母親的知覺準確性可能與兒童或母親的背景變項有關,未來仍需進一步釐清影響母親知覺準確性的機轉以提供預防兒童體重異常的臨床工作者做為參考之依據。
Purpose: To explored those factors which related to the accuracy of maternal perception of children’s weight status and the relationships between the accuracy of maternal perception of children’s weight and children health behaviors.
Methods: A national representative sample of 3-11 year-old children and their mothers from 2005 Taiwan National Health Interview Survey were examined. The demographic characteristics of children and mothers, children’s body mass index (BMI), mothers’ perceptions of child’s weight status and child health behavior, such as dietary patterns, weight management behaviors, and spending time on sedentary activities were collected by a questionnaire. Pearson’s chi-square test was used to analyze the different of characteristics among each weight status, the relationships of the accuracy of maternal weight perception, and child health behaviors. Logistic regression was used to evaluate the relationships of the accuracy of maternal perception and each predictor.
Results: Nearly 45% of 3-11 year-old children’s BMI were abnormal, and 24.4% of them were overweight and obesity. In maternal perception of children’s weight, 35% of them were misperceived. Child age, mother’s age, mother’s ethnicity and monthly household income were related to the accuracy of maternal perception of children’s weight. Mothers with younger children, younger mothers, aboriginal mothers and monthly household income less than NT$30,000 have higher risk in misperceiving their children’s weight. The relationships between the accuracy of maternal perception and child health behaviors was statistical significant. The aboriginal BMI children of mothers with accuracy perception would engage in correct weight control direction. Besides, mothers with accuracy perception of their children’s weight and children spending less time on watching TV and computer/video game playing, could have more consumption in vegetable and fruits intake.
Conclusion: The accuracy of maternal perception of children’s weight was related to children’s health behaviors such as correct weight control direction, spending less hours on sedentary activities and more healthy dietary intake. Given the accuracy of maternal perception of children’s weight related to the demographic characteristics of mother and children, its mechanism needs to be clarified in the future.
